Artist Jessica Diggins is a UK painter and tattoo apprentice. She also is a self proclaimed insomniac/night creature and caffeine junkie. Jessica's favorite subject is clearly nude and tattooed women. Be sure to take a look at her tumblr, she gives a little back story to all of her works.